Staged Explosion Throwing Darts

Throwing darts that once thrown launch a projectile under their own power.

Throwing darts are typically centrally weighted with tapering in both directions away from the centre. In one direction is the needle point, and in the other direction is the fletching.

These throwing darts would be charged much like firecrackers, but with a small amount of explosive packed into the centre cavity. When thrown, the drag that is produced on the trailing end triggers the charge.

Once the charge detonates the relatively massless needle accelerates away from the weighted centre, which decellerates or changes direction as a result of the explosion.
